Valtteri Bottas says that during his time with Mercedes he learned that “if you can get the spirit up, it really boosts the performance in every area”.
Ahead of his first season with Alfa Romeo, Valtteri Bottas talked to The Race about how he intends to pull from his vast experience with the dominant Mercedes team, to help his new team grow.
“I’ve been inside a team that knows how to win, what it really takes in terms of the teamwork, in terms of the machinery and how you work,” the Finn said.
“With the team spirit, I’ve learned so much that actually if you can get the spirit up, it really boosts the performance in every area.”

“I’m going to help the team with all the experience and expertise I’ve gathered, I’ve learned.
“All my years in Formula 1 has made me so much stronger, so much smarter. So much stronger with the technical knowledge as well.
“There’s so many things that I’ve already been able to guide, information I’ve been able to give to the team, and there will be so much in the future. It’s going to be hard work.
“I’m more than ready to do my part on that and make sure the people around me do that,” Bottas concluded.
